Porter township is located in Clarion County, Pennsylvania. Porter township has a 2025 population of 1,227. Porter township is currently declining at a rate of -1.05% annually and its population has decreased by -4.44%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 1,284 in 2020.

The average household income in Porter township is $85,901 with a poverty rate of 20.56%.The median age in Porter township is 42.9 years: 46.1 years for males, and 41.3 years for females.

Porter township's average per capita income is $40,313. Household income levels show a median of $68,333. The poverty rate stands at 20.56%.

Families: A family includes the owner or renter of the home along with everyone related to them - whether through birth, marriage, or adoption. This includes relatives like spouses, children, parents, siblings, grandparents, and any other family members.
Households: A household includes all the people who occupy a housing unit (such as a house or apartment) as their usual place of residence.
Non Families: A nonfamily household is either someone living alone or when the owner/renter lives with people they aren't related to, like roommates.
